Seep Willow

Baccharis salicifolia

Field Notes

Description:

Woody evergreen bush with pink buds and white flowers. Leaves are sticky and lanceolate.

Habitat:

Along trail in mixed-chaparral area.

Notes:

This plant is native to California. Aka Mule Fat or Water-wally
